Locked Out

If you've ever locked out of your car you are aware that it can be stressful. It is important to be at peace and find the best option. There are numerous ways to enter the car without causing damage to it and a locksmith for your car can assist you in this. They can rekey a lock, replace the lock on a door and make new keys and much more. It's also a good idea to keep a spare key in case this happens again.

The most common reason for a car lockout is when the key is lost or locked inside the vehicle. In these instances, calling a locksmith is generally simple. They can unlock the car quickly and without causing damage. If the car is old, you might need special tools or a new key.

It could be risky to try to employ a coathanger or another tools that are made-up. This can lead to expensive repairs. Trying to break into the car through the window may cause serious injuries. The risk isn't worth it. In this situation you should contact a nearby locksmith to get help.

Most locksmiths charge a fee for unlocking your car. The cost ranges from $50 to $125 based on the work to be done. The cost will also be affected by the type of vehicle, and the complexity of lock.

In addition to unlocking your vehicle, locksmiths can also rekey your locks or change the ignition switch. These services are generally more expensive than simple lockouts. These services are more costly however they are worth in the long run as they ensure that your vehicle is secure.

Transponder Keys

You own a remarkable piece of technology if you have a vehicle equipped with a transponder, or chip key. This kind of key has a microchip on the head which sends a message to the car whenever the key is inserted into the ignition. The car will then interpret the signal and if it is the correct code, it will start. The car will not start in the event that the signal is wrong. This is a fantastic security feature that has decreased car thefts.

In the past stealing cars was as easy as touching two wires together in a process known as hot wiring. But this is no longer feasible with chip keys since they require radio frequency to start the car. They are much safer than the old-fashioned keys. This is also the reason they cost more because the chips are more sophisticated and they need to be manufactured at the dealership, but this extra security is worth the extra cost for a lot of drivers.

Keyless Entry

Many car owners are searching for a simple and fast way to enter their vehicle. This is the reason why many opt for keyless entry systems. These car locksmith near you systems do away with the need for a key, using the wireless signal from a fob, or for newer vehicles, directly from the vehicle.

A fob looks very much similar to a standard car key, however it has a specific "chip" inside that relays an encrypted code to the vehicle when it is pressed. This is how you can unlock the door and begin the engine. This type of keyless entry is utilized in all newer vehicles. It is practical to not have to search through purses or pockets for keys.

However, it's crucial to be aware that these systems could also make it easier for thieves. Criminals may use specialized equipment to capture the signal that is transmitted between your fob, and the car. This can trick the car into thinking that you are in the vehicle. This type of theft, referred to as'relay crime', is a common occurrence.

To prevent this from happening avoid this, keep your key fob in a case with a metallic lining (pictured below). This stops radio signals from being amplified and used to unlock your car. These pouches are available online or in your local auto shop.
